How to Use

To use the quick bar, type .quickbar and the following window will show up.

The quick bar can be moved by grabbing the edge of the window and dragged into another location.  However this will only move the window for this session. 

If you want to permanently set the location you nick to click the lower left of the icons on the right hand side of the window.

That will bring up this screen:

You can use the gold arrows to move the window into the location you would like it permanently to display, or you can enter the X and Y coordinates of your screen.

When you are done, press apply and then okay.

From now on, when you type .quickbar the bar will launch into this location on your screen.

The arrows on the icon section allow you page thru your icons.  There are nine pages of icons.

You can also expand the screen to show two rows of icons by clicking the lower triangle looking graphic.

You will now have a double row of icons:

You can close it back up to one row by reclicking the triangle.

The icon in the upper left will be for various options but is not currently implemented.

To add an icon to your tool bar click a blue button.

This will bring up the add icon window.

You can use either gump or tile art to display on your quickbar.

You will then need to enter the graphic ID:

You can enter the graphics number of either gumps or tiles.  To get a complete list of available gumps and tiles, down load a copy of inside uo and install it.

Gump are is on the gump section of Inside UO.

The graphic number is show in the lower left corner of the screen:

Use the first number.

Tile art is found on the Artwork section of Inside UO.

The graphic number is show under the model no in the lower left hand corner, use the first number.

Once you have entered the number hit the apply. I have entered 2430 for cheese in this example:

(Some graphics are BIG and will look stupid on the bar, I suggest you use ones that fit nicely.)

For Example:

The Text Section is currently not implemented.

Now you need to enter one of the available commands and their associated parameters.  The list of available commands is below.

When you are done click apply.

If you change your mind click cancel.

To clear this slot click clear slot.

Now your icon is available and you can click the graphic to activate the spell.

Command Line Options for the Quick bar

.quickbar clear all Will wipe out all of your quick bar settings for this character. Requires the quickbar to be closed.
.quickbar clear {page#} {slot#} Will clear out the slot on the page requested.  Requires the quickbar to be closed.
.quickbar {page#} Opens the quick bar to that page.  Requires the quickbar to be closed.
.quickbar resetposition Resets the save position to its default, incase you loose it. Requires the quickbar to be closed.
.quickbar kill if the quick bar is running it will skill the script so that you can relauch the quickbar if for any reason you can't close it normally.

Available Command List

Command Parameter
castspell spell id # (the list is not yet available)
ability same parameters used in the .ability command as listed under the special ability page
useskill

Anatomy , Blacksmithy , Peacemaking , Leadership , Invocation , Hiding , Provocation , Inscription , Magery, Poisoning, Necromancy, Stealing, Taming, Tracking, Veterinary, MineralHarvesting, Meditation, Stealth, Druidry, Clericy

useitem click the item button on the edit window and target the item you wish to use.  it will add text to the parameter line, do NOT remove this or it wont work.

Additional Ones Are Planned
